Transaction 7009e9ca696e34849bf822841f3322586a718d5de821bc917a6fdde14835844a
1 Input
1 Output
-
7009e9ca696e34849bf822841f3322586a718d5de821bc917a6fdde14835844a:0
- value
- 516834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beefc6c35605957180befbfdb5ed90a99bd2282a OP_EQUAL
- address
- 3K6bYx18YR1FoAMukakUKSqVMfa8UJDHWX